IE AntiVirus (IEAntiVirus) Removal Instructions


IE AntiVirus, also known as IEAntiVirus or IE AntiVirus 3.2 , a rogue anti-spyware application by itself but advertises itself as a removal tool. This annoying rogue antispyware application is back after changing its face mask. It is believed that it is a variant of Malware Bell, IE Defender or Files Secure. As a matter of fact, it is one of the latest counterfeit anti-spyware softwares that causes troubles for so many innocent computer users today.

Technically, IE AntiVirus usually installed itself onto your PC without your permission, through Vundo Trojan, Zlob Trojan, Virus or fake software. IEAntiVirus will also display fake system alerts or fake security alerts to trick user to buy the paid version of IE AntiVirus. However, it’s so untrue and misleading. Not only does it cause your machine to slow down or degrade dramatically, it would also put your privacy and data in risk. To avoid further damages, it’s highly recommended to remove IE AntiVirus if your computer is infected. Before any modifications to your system, please be sure to back up the critical data first. Manual Removal Instructions:

Stop IEAntiVirus Processes:
(Learn how to do this)
ieav.exe
ieavinstaller.exe

Find and Delete these IEAntiVirus Files:
(Learn how to do this)
ieav.exe
ieavinstaller.exe
%desktopdirectory%\ie antivirus 3.2.lnk
%program_files%\ieantivirus\ieas.db2
%program_files%\ieantivirus\uninst.exe
%program_files%\ieantivirus\ieav.exe
%program_files%\ieantivirus\ieas.db3
%program_files%\ieantivirus\ieav.exe
%program_files%\ieantivirus\uninst.exe
%programs%\ie antivirus 3.2.lnk

Remove IEAntiVirus Registry Values:
(Learn how to do this)
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\ieantivirus
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\microsoft\windows\currentversion\run antispy
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\microsoft\windows\currentversion\run antispy
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\microsoft\windows\currentversion\uninstall\ie antivirus
